Comprehending Compression Therapy: The Scientific research Behind It
Compression therapy plays a vital function in managing various clinical problems by using regulated pressure to specific body locations. This healing technique uses elastic products, such as plasters or compression garments, to enhance venous return and reduce swelling. By pressing the cells, blood circulation is redirected toward the heart, alleviating issues connected to bad flow.
The science behind compression therapy includes the concepts of hemodynamics and hydrostatics, where outside pressure helps keep liquid balance in cells - Compression. It is particularly effective in conditions such as persistent venous insufficiency, lymphedema, and varicose blood vessels. Furthermore, compression therapy can avoid the development of embolism by promoting blood circulation
Comprehending the mechanisms of compression therapy emphasizes its value in medical practice, leading healthcare experts in properly releasing this therapy technique for optimal patient results.

Medical Compression Stockings
Clinical compression stockings play an important duty in the management of different circulatory conditions by using graduated pressure to the legs. These stockings are made to enhance blood circulation, decrease swelling, and relieve discomfort linked with venous disorders, such as varicose blood vessels and persistent venous lack. They come in different styles, consisting of knee-high, thigh-high, and complete pantyhose, dealing with specific demands and preferences. Compression degrees typically vary from light to extra firm, permitting doctor to recommend the suitable kind based upon the extent of the condition. Appropriate installation is essential for effectiveness; as a result, people ought to seek advice from medical care specialists to guarantee they select the appropriate size and compression level. Routine usage can greatly enhance overall leg health and comfort.

Common Myths and False Impressions Concerning Compression Therapy
Compression therapy is often surrounded by numerous misconceptions and false impressions that can bring about misunderstandings regarding its purpose and effectiveness. One common misconception is that compression garments are just for those with existing clinical problems, when in truth, they can benefit anyone, reference especially professional athletes looking for enhanced performance and recuperation. In addition, some believe that wearing compression items is awkward or limiting; nonetheless, contemporary materials and layouts prioritize comfort and fit. An additional false impression is that compression therapy can completely heal problems like varicose capillaries, while it is really a helpful therapy that helps in signs and symptom administration. The notion that higher compression levels are always far better is misinforming; the suitable degree differs based on private requirements. Finally, several believe that compression therapy needs a prescription, however many products are readily available over the counter for general usage. Compression Degree Option
Selecting the appropriate level of compression is essential for optimizing the advantages of compression therapy. Compression degrees are commonly classified by millimeters of mercury (mmHg), with lower levels (8-15 mmHg) suitable for moderate conditions such as fatigue and swelling. Modest levels (15-20 mmHg) are commonly advised for taking care of varicose veins and small edema, while greater levels (20-30 mmHg or even more) are generally reserved for more severe problems like deep vein thrombosis or chronic venous lack. It is crucial to consider specific wellness requirements, lifestyle, and any hidden medical conditions when picking the compression degree. Consulting with a healthcare professional can give useful assistance in selecting one of the most proper compression level for the finest therapeutic end results.
